Exploring the USC Computer Science Acceptance Rate: A Comprehensive Guide

Exploring the USC Computer Science Acceptance Rate: A Comprehensive Guide
Exploring the USC Computer Science Acceptance Rate: A Comprehensive Guide

Welcome to our in-depth guide on the USC Computer Science acceptance rate. If you are considering pursuing a degree in computer science at the University of Southern California (USC), understanding the acceptance rate is a crucial aspect of your decision-making process. In this article, we will provide you with detailed information about the USC Computer Science acceptance rate, including the requirements, factors influencing acceptance, and tips to increase your chances of acceptance.

At USC, the Computer Science program is highly competitive and attracts numerous talented applicants from around the world. As a result, the acceptance rate for the USC Computer Science program is an important metric to consider. By exploring the acceptance rate, you can gain insights into the level of competition and understand what it takes to secure admission into this prestigious program.

Understanding the USC Computer Science Program

In this section, we will provide an overview of the USC Computer Science program, highlighting its strengths, faculty, and areas of specialization. By understanding the program’s unique features, you can make an informed decision about whether it aligns with your academic and career goals.

Program Overview

The USC Computer Science program is known for its excellence in research and education. It offers a comprehensive curriculum that covers a wide range of topics in computer science, including algorithms, artificial intelligence, software engineering, and more. The program aims to equip students with the necessary skills and knowledge to excel in the rapidly evolving field of computer science.

Faculty Expertise

The faculty members at USC’s Computer Science department are renowned experts in their respective fields. They bring a wealth of knowledge and experience to the classroom, conducting cutting-edge research and actively contributing to advancements in the field of computer science. As a student in the program, you will have the opportunity to learn from and collaborate with these distinguished professors.

Areas of Specialization

The USC Computer Science program offers a variety of areas of specialization, allowing students to tailor their education to their specific interests and career goals. Some of the areas of specialization include data science, machine learning, cybersecurity, human-computer interaction, and more. By choosing a specialization, you can delve deeper into a particular field within computer science and develop expertise in that area.

Factors Influencing the Acceptance Rate

Discover the key factors that influence the USC Computer Science acceptance rate. From GPA requirements to standardized test scores and extracurricular involvement, we will delve into the various aspects that admissions committees consider when evaluating applicants.

Academic Performance

One of the most significant factors that admissions committees consider is your academic performance, especially your GPA. USC Computer Science program typically looks for applicants with a strong academic background, particularly in math and science-related subjects. A high GPA demonstrates your ability to handle the rigorous coursework in the program.

READ :  Mastering the Art of Sharing Computer Audio on Teams: A Step-by-Step Guide

Standardized Test Scores

In addition to your GPA, standardized test scores, such as the SAT or ACT, play a crucial role in the admissions process. USC Computer Science program typically has a minimum score requirement that applicants must meet to be considered for admission. It is essential to prepare for these tests thoroughly and aim for scores that are competitive with other applicants.

Coursework and Prerequisites

Admissions committees also consider the coursework you have completed and the prerequisites you have fulfilled. USC Computer Science program typically requires applicants to have a strong foundation in math and science-related subjects, such as calculus, physics, and computer science. By completing relevant coursework and meeting the prerequisites, you demonstrate your preparedness for the program.

Extracurricular Involvement

While academics are crucial, USC Computer Science program also values applicants who showcase their passion and dedication outside of the classroom. Engaging in extracurricular activities related to computer science, such as participating in coding competitions, joining computer science clubs, or contributing to open-source projects, can significantly enhance your application and demonstrate your commitment to the field.

Historical Acceptance Rates

Explore the historical acceptance rates for the USC Computer Science program over the past few years. By analyzing these trends, you can gain a better understanding of the competitiveness and the potential trajectory of the acceptance rate.

Acceptance Rate Trends

Over the years, the acceptance rate for the USC Computer Science program has fluctuated, reflecting the level of competition and the number of applicants. It is important to note that acceptance rates can vary from year to year, and they are influenced by various factors, such as the applicant pool’s quality and the available spots in the program.

Comparing Acceptance Rates

When examining historical acceptance rates, it can be helpful to compare them to other programs within USC or similar computer science programs at other universities. This comparison can provide insights into the competitiveness of the USC Computer Science program and help you gauge your chances of acceptance.

Projected Acceptance Rate

While it is challenging to predict the exact acceptance rate for future years, analyzing historical data and trends can give you a rough estimate of what to expect. However, it is important to remember that these projections are not definitive and should be used as a general guideline rather than a guarantee.

Admission Requirements

In this section, we will provide an in-depth overview of the admission requirements for the USC Computer Science program. From academic prerequisites to supporting documents, such as recommendation letters and personal statements, we will guide you through the necessary steps to apply successfully.

Academic Prerequisites

USC Computer Science program typically requires applicants to have completed specific coursework as part of their high school or college education. These prerequisites vary depending on the program and may include subjects like calculus, physics, and computer science. It is crucial to review the program’s official website or contact the admissions office for the most up-to-date information on academic prerequisites.

Standardized Tests

As mentioned earlier, standardized test scores play a significant role in the admissions process. USC Computer Science program typically requires applicants to submit their SAT or ACT scores. It is important to familiarize yourself with the program’s minimum score requirements and prepare diligently for these tests to achieve competitive scores.

Letters of Recommendation

Most universities, including USC, require applicants to submit letters of recommendation as part of their application. These letters should come from individuals who can speak to your academic abilities, personal qualities, and potential for success in the USC Computer Science program. It is essential to choose recommenders who know you well and can provide meaningful insights into your qualifications.

READ :  UCSB Computer Science Acceptance Rate: What You Need to Know

Personal Statement

The personal statement is an opportunity for you to showcase your passion for computer science, highlight your achievements, and explain why you are interested in the USC Computer Science program specifically. Use this essay to demonstrate your uniqueness, reflect on your experiences, and explain how you will contribute to the academic community at USC.

Additional Requirements

Along with the academic prerequisites, standardized tests, letters of recommendation, and personal statement, USC Computer Science program may have additional requirements, such as a portfolio of your programming projects or a resume detailing your relevant experiences. It is important to review the program’s official website or contact the admissions office to ensure you meet all the necessary requirements.

Strategies to Increase Your Chances of Acceptance

Learn valuable strategies and tips to enhance your chances of acceptance into the USC Computer Science program. From academic preparation to showcasing your passion for computer science, we will provide you with actionable advice to strengthen your application.

Academic Preparation

To increase your chances of acceptance, focus on excelling in your academic coursework. Maintain a high GPA, particularly in math and science-related subjects. Consider taking advanced courses or participating in programs that offer college-level computer science classes to demonstrate your commitment and readiness for the program.

Extracurricular Involvement

Engage in extracurricular activities that showcase your passion for computer science. Join computer science clubs, participate in coding competitions, or contribute to open-source projects. These activities not only demonstrate your dedication to the field but also provide valuable experiences that can set you apart from other applicants.

Research and Internship Opportunities

Consider seeking research or internship opportunities in computer science-related fields. These experiences can provide you with hands-on exposure to the field, allow you to work with professionals in the industry, and demonstrate your ability to apply theoretical knowledge to real-world problems. Research and internship experiences can significantly enhance your application and make you a more competitive candidate.

Showcase Your Passion

In your personal statement and other application materials, make sure to effectively communicate your passion for computer science. Reflect on your experiences, share compelling stories, and explain how your interest in the field has grown over time. Admissions committees are looking for applicants who genuinely love computer science and can contribute to the academic community at USC.

Scholarships and Financial Aid

Discover the various scholarships and financial aid opportunities available specifically for USC Computer Science students. We will guide you through the process of applying for financial assistance and highlight the resources that can help alleviate the burden of tuition costs.

Scholarship Opportunities

USC offers a range of scholarships specifically for computer science students. These scholarships may be based on academic merit

Scholarship Opportunities (continued)

USC offers a range of scholarships specifically for computer science students. These scholarships may be based on academic merit, financial need, or a combination of both. It is crucial to research and identify the scholarships for which you may be eligible and carefully follow the application instructions and deadlines.

Financial Aid

In addition to scholarships, USC provides various forms of financial aid to help make education more affordable for students. This includes need-based grants, loans, and work-study programs. To determine your eligibility for financial aid, you will need to complete the Free Application for Federal Student Aid (FAFSA) and any additional financial aid forms required by USC.

Resources and Support

USC has dedicated financial aid offices and advisors who can assist you throughout the application process and provide guidance on available resources. They can help you understand the different types of financial aid, assist with completing the necessary forms, and answer any questions you may have regarding scholarships and financial assistance.

READ :  How to Create a Winning Computer Science Student Resume with No Experience

Student Experiences and Testimonials

Read about the experiences and testimonials of current and former USC Computer Science students. By gaining insights into their journeys, challenges, and successes, you can better envision yourself as part of the USC Computer Science community.

Student Stories

Explore stories shared by current and former USC Computer Science students. These students can provide valuable insights into their experiences with the program, including their coursework, research opportunities, and involvement in extracurricular activities. Reading about their journeys can give you a glimpse into the supportive community and the opportunities available at USC.

Challenges and Triumphs

Discover the challenges faced by USC Computer Science students and how they overcame them. From managing a rigorous academic workload to balancing extracurricular commitments, these stories can provide you with inspiration and guidance as you navigate your own path in the program.

Advice and Tips

Current and former USC Computer Science students often share advice and tips for prospective students. They offer insights into maximizing your experience at USC, making the most of available resources, and balancing academics with extracurricular pursuits. Their advice can provide you with valuable guidance as you embark on your own USC Computer Science journey.

Career Prospects and Alumni Success

Explore the wide range of career prospects and opportunities available to USC Computer Science graduates. From industry partnerships to alumni success stories, we will showcase how the program prepares students for a successful future in the field of computer science.

Industry Partnerships

USC Computer Science program often collaborates with industry partners to provide students with internship and job placement opportunities. These partnerships can give you access to internships at top technology companies, networking events, and mentorship programs. They also provide insights into the skills and knowledge sought by employers in the field.

Alumni Success Stories

Explore the success stories of USC Computer Science alumni who have gone on to achieve remarkable careers in the field. These stories can inspire and motivate you as you envision your own future. They also demonstrate the potential career paths and opportunities available to USC Computer Science graduates.

Career Support Services

USC offers comprehensive career support services to computer science students, including resume workshops, interview preparation, and job search assistance. These resources can help you navigate the job market, connect with potential employers, and secure internships or full-time positions after graduation.

Frequently Asked Questions

In this section, we will address common questions and concerns related to the USC Computer Science acceptance rate. From application timelines to international student considerations, we aim to provide comprehensive answers to help you make informed decisions.

When is the application deadline for the USC Computer Science program?

The application deadline for the USC Computer Science program varies each year. It is essential to check the program’s official website or contact the admissions office for the most up-to-date information regarding application deadlines.

Is the USC Computer Science program open to international students?

Yes, the USC Computer Science program welcomes applications from international students. USC values diversity and encourages students from around the world to apply. However, international applicants may have additional requirements, such as demonstrating English language proficiency through standardized tests like the TOEFL or IELTS.

What is the average class size in the USC Computer Science program?

The average class size in the USC Computer Science program can vary depending on the specific course and level. Some introductory courses may have larger class sizes, while upper-level courses and specialized seminars tend to have smaller class sizes to facilitate more personalized instruction and interaction with faculty.

Does USC offer scholarships specifically for computer science students?

Yes, USC offers scholarships specifically for computer science students. These scholarships may be based on academic merit, financial need, or a combination of both. It is important to research and identify the scholarships for which you may be eligible and carefully follow the application instructions and deadlines.

In conclusion, understanding the USC Computer Science acceptance rate is essential for prospective students who aspire to pursue a degree in this field. By familiarizing yourself with the program, admission requirements, and strategies to increase your chances, you can approach the application process with confidence. Remember, while the acceptance rate may appear competitive, with dedication, passion, and thorough preparation, you can maximize your chances of securing a spot in the USC Computer Science program and embark on an exciting academic journey.

Rian Suryadi

Tech Insights for a Brighter Future

Related Post

Leave a Comment